Output f53ae005bfda0453901b0b587fc31184e5c5acb6351b28a73d14d4caffc0917f:23

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 c8a34bdd9fe82cdfb4aa31149f4f725caf6175c3
address
bc1qez35hhvlaqkdld92xy2f7nmjtjhkzawr4plutc
transaction
f53ae005bfda0453901b0b587fc31184e5c5acb6351b28a73d14d4caffc0917f
confirmations
59730
spent
true